My paper with Susan Allen, @jilian0717.bsky.social, @jaytcullen.bsky.social, & @tiaanderlini.bsky.social is out! We show how Pacific source waters shape property flux into the Salish Sea, and separate dynamical vs property-driven changeβuseful for understanding coastal conditions in a changing ocean
The discovery of the first major lithium-bearing pegmatite in B.C. β and the geochemistry behind it β could help make Canada more self-sufficient in #criticalminerals resources.
@eoas.ubc.ca mineralogist Dr. Catriona Breasley discusses her discovery via @science.ubc.ca

πͺ¨ First geochemical analyses of asteroid Bennu (Nature Astronomy)!
UBCβs Dr. Dominique Weis, Dr. Marghaleray Amini & Vivian Lai (PCIGR/EOAS) joined nearly 100 scientists showing Bennu formed >4.5B yrs agoβwith grains older than the Sun.

π A decade-long mystery solved: UBC-led researchers identified the bacteria behind sea star wasting disease (Vibrio pectenicida FHCF-3), published in Nature Ecology & Evolution.
A huge step for marine recovery. πͺΈπ
